One of the standout Peppermint Recipes is the classic Mint Julep, a refreshing cocktail that originated in the American South. This timeless concoction combines whiskey, sugar syrup, fresh mint leaves, and ice, creating a harmonious blend of sweet and tart notes. The use of high-quality ingredients and freshly muddled mint ensures an optimal experience, making it a popular choice for both formal gatherings and casual get-togethers alike. One of the most effective methods to highlight peppermint's natural vibrancy is through infusion. Adding fresh peppermint leaves to oils, syrups, or even simple sugars allows for a nuanced extraction of flavor without overwhelming the palate. For instance, a mint-infused honey not only sweetens beverages but also imparts a subtle, refreshing taste that enhances teas and cocktails. Similarly, peppermint-infused olive oil can transform a basic salad dressing into a vibrant, aromatic creation. This technique underscores the importance of subtlety in peppermint recipes, where less is often more to capture the essence without overpowering other flavors.

Beyond infusion, incorporating peppermint in various culinary forms showcases its versatility. Incorporating fresh or dried peppermint into baked goods like cookies and cakes provides a delightful crunch and flavor profile. Herbs like peppermint can also be cooked gently in sauces or used as garnishes, adding complexity to main courses. For example, a simple mint sauce accompanying lamb or pork not only refreshes the palate but also elevates the overall dining experience. Expert chefs often emphasize the importance of balancing peppermint's cooling effect with warming spices like cinnamon or nutmeg to create harmonious, complex dishes.
